On Tue, Nov 24, 2009 at 01:17:41AM -0700, Grant Likely wrote:
> Nothing much to say here other than mostly mechanical merging of OF
> support code. Some of it remains a little ugly, but I'm taking the
> approach of merging the code first, and refactoring it second.
>
> I've pushed this series out to my test-devicetree branch on my git
> server if anyone wants to test. That branch also includes the
> previous 2 patch series that I've sent out.
>
> git://git.secretlab.ca/git/linux-2.6 test-devicetree
>
> Compile tested on: ppc64, ppc32, microblaze, sparc64, sparc32.
> Boot tested on mpc5200 (ppc32) platform.
test-devicetree as of today also works fine on my phyCORE-MPC5200B-IO.
Tested-by: Wolfram Sang <w.sang@pengutronix.de>
